متن کاملThe contribution of color to motion in normal and color-deficient observers.
By opposing drifting luminance and color gratings, we have measured the "equivalent luminance contrast" of color, the contribution that color makes to motion. We found that this equivalent contrast was highest (greater than 10%) for low spatial and temporal frequencies and was higher for red/green than for blue/yellow stimuli. متن کاملThe contribution of color to visual memory in normal and color deficient observers
We used a recognition memory paradigm to assess the influence of color information on visual memory for color images of natural scenes. During the presentation phase 48 images of natural scenes were presented on a CRT for exposure durations between 50 and 1000 msec followed by a random noise mask.
